 Beauty wise, I enjoyed three products last month:

Essie Nail Polish in Roarrrrange- I actually made a blog post about this one. Which I will link here. Although this is definitely more of a summer color, it transitioned well for me into the fall. It tended to go well with what I was wearing and isn't too showy, which is surprising considering it's orange. 

YSL Rouge Volupte Lipstick in #13 Peach Passion- This is the first product from YSL that I've ever tried and I was really impressed. It's super moisturizing and is a beautiful color for daytime wear. The only complaint I would have is that it doesn't last all day, however it's simple to reapply and doesn't take as much work as some other lipsticks do.

Estee Lauder Bronze Goddess Bronzer in Medium Deep- Firstly, my skin is VERY pale, yet medium deep worked well with it. I love this bronzer because of it's buildable quality and the color it gives you is beautiful without being overpowering. I would suggest this for anyone just looking for an everyday wear bronzer. Plus, it's huge and can last for quite some time. 


Entertainment wise, I've enjoyed two things. One is the comic book series called Saga. If you like to read comics or have ever wanted to start, I would HIGHLY recommend these. Currently, there's three volumes in graphic novel form. However, they do release these chapter by chapter as well. The story line is well thought out and the art is impeccable. If you like fantasy, you won't go wrong with these. The next thing is 642 Things to Write About which i bought on a whim in Barnes & Noble one day. It has a lot of different prompts for you to write about, and it helps to get your brain turned on and the creative juices flowing, especially if you're stuck on something. This is also rather good when you're bored and want to do something different. Recommend for anyone who wants to try their hand at writing but don't know where to start.
